ไปยังเนื้อหาหลัก

จะสร้างการตรวจสอบข้อมูลภายนอกในแผ่นงานหรือสมุดงานอื่นได้อย่างไร

ผู้เขียน: ซัน แก้ไขล่าสุด: 2020-05-28

โดยทั่วไปเราใช้การตรวจสอบข้อมูลเพื่อ จำกัด ผู้ใช้ในการป้อนค่าที่เราต้องการ แต่คุณเคยพยายามสร้างการตรวจสอบข้อมูลภายนอกในแผ่นรองหรือสมุดงานหรือไม่ซึ่งหมายความว่าข้อมูลต้นทางและการตรวจสอบข้อมูลไม่อยู่ในแผ่นงานเดียวกันหรือ สมุดงานเดียวกันหรือไม่ ในบทความนี้ฉันจะแนะนำวิธีการจัดการกับปัญหานี้ใน Excel

สร้างการตรวจสอบข้อมูลภายนอกในแผ่นงานอื่น

สร้างการตรวจสอบข้อมูลภายนอกในสมุดงานอื่น


ลูกศรสีฟ้าฟองขวา สร้างการตรวจสอบข้อมูลภายนอกในแผ่นงานอื่น

สร้างรายการแบบหล่นลงเช่นฉันจะสร้างซอร์สในแผ่นงานเดียวจากนั้นใช้ชื่อช่วงเพื่อสร้างรายการแบบหล่นลงในแผ่นงานอื่นตามแหล่งที่มาของค่า

1. สร้างค่าแหล่งที่มาของรายการแบบหล่นลงในแผ่นงานตามที่คุณต้องการ ดูภาพหน้าจอ:
การตรวจสอบข้อมูลภายนอก doc 1

2. เลือกค่าแหล่งที่มาเหล่านี้และไปที่ ชื่อ: กล่อง เพื่อกำหนดชื่อช่วงสำหรับเซลล์ฉันจะป้อนที่นี่ ประเทศ ใน ชื่อ: กล่องจากนั้นกด เข้าสู่ กุญแจสำคัญในการสิ้นสุดการตั้งชื่อ ดูภาพหน้าจอ:
การตรวจสอบข้อมูลภายนอก doc 2

3. ไปที่แผ่นงานที่คุณต้องการสร้างรายการแบบหล่นลงภายนอกและเลือกเซลล์หรือช่วงที่จะวางรายการแบบหล่นลงเช่น G1: G4 แล้วคลิก ข้อมูล > การตรวจสอบข้อมูล. ดูภาพหน้าจอ:
การตรวจสอบข้อมูลภายนอก doc 3

4 ใน การตรวจสอบข้อมูล โต้ตอบคลิก การตั้งค่า และเลือก รายการ จาก อนุญาต รายการแบบหล่นลงจากนั้นป้อน = ประเทศ (ประเทศคือชื่อที่คุณกำหนดไว้สำหรับช่วงแหล่งที่มาในขั้นตอนที่ 2 คุณสามารถเปลี่ยนได้ตามที่คุณต้องการ) ลงในช่องของ แหล่ง. ดูภาพหน้าจอ:
การตรวจสอบข้อมูลภายนอก doc 4

5 คลิก OKตอนนี้การตรวจสอบข้อมูลภายนอกได้ถูกสร้างขึ้นแล้ว
การตรวจสอบข้อมูลภายนอก doc 5


ลูกศรสีฟ้าฟองขวา สร้างการตรวจสอบข้อมูลภายนอกในสมุดงานอื่น

ในการสร้างการตรวจสอบข้อมูลภายนอกในสมุดงานอื่นคุณต้องใช้ช่วงชื่อด้วย

สร้างรายการแบบหล่นลงเช่น

1. สร้างค่าแหล่งที่มาตามที่คุณต้องการในแผ่นงานจากนั้นเลือกค่าแหล่งที่มาและไปที่ ชื่อ: กล่อง เพื่อตั้งชื่อช่วงต้นทางและกด เข้าสู่ ที่สำคัญใช้เวลา CusName เช่น ดูภาพหน้าจอ:
การตรวจสอบข้อมูลภายนอก doc 6

2. จากนั้นไปที่สมุดงานที่คุณต้องการสร้างรายการแบบหล่นลงเลือกคอลัมน์ว่างในแผ่นงานเช่นคอลัมน์ J แล้วคลิก สูตร > กำหนดชื่อ. ดูภาพหน้าจอ:
การตรวจสอบข้อมูลภายนอก doc 7

3 ใน ชื่อใหม่ ให้ป้อนชื่อในไฟล์ Name แล้วเลือก สมุดงาน จาก ขอบเขต จากนั้นพิมพ์สูตรนี้ = Source.xlsx! CustName (แหล่งที่มาคือชื่อสมุดงานของสมุดงานที่เป็นแหล่งข้อมูลและ CustName คือชื่อช่วงที่คุณสร้างขึ้นสำหรับข้อมูลต้นทางในขั้นตอนที่ 1 คุณสามารถเปลี่ยนได้ตามต้องการ) ใน อ้างถึง กล่องข้อความ. ดูภาพหน้าจอ:
การตรวจสอบข้อมูลภายนอก doc 8

4 คลิก OK. จากนั้นไปที่เลือกช่วงที่คุณต้องการสร้างรายการแบบหล่นลงภายนอก L1: L4 แล้วคลิก ข้อมูล > การตรวจสอบข้อมูล. ดูภาพหน้าจอ:
การตรวจสอบข้อมูลภายนอก doc 9

5 ใน การตรวจสอบข้อมูล โต้ตอบคลิก การตั้งค่า และเลือก รายการ ราคาเริ่มต้นที่ อนุญาต รายการแบบเลื่อนลงและป้อนสูตรนี้ = MyCustList (MyCustList เป็นชื่อช่วงที่คุณตั้งให้คอลัมน์ว่างในขั้นตอนที่ 3 คุณสามารถเปลี่ยนได้ตามต้องการ) ลงใน แหล่ง กล่อง. ดูภาพหน้าจอ:
การตรวจสอบข้อมูลภายนอก doc 10

6 คลิก OK. ตอนนี้การตรวจสอบข้อมูลภายนอกในสมุดงานอื่นได้ถูกสร้างขึ้นแล้ว ดูภาพหน้าจอ:
การตรวจสอบข้อมูลภายนอก doc 11

หมายเหตุ: เฉพาะเมื่อเปิดสมุดงานสองเล่มพร้อมกัน (สมุดงานแหล่งข้อมูลและสมุดงานตรวจสอบข้อมูล) การตรวจสอบความถูกต้องของข้อมูลภายนอกจะทำงานได้อย่างถูกต้อง

สุดยอดเครื่องมือเพิ่มผลผลิตในสำนักงาน

🤖 Kutools AI ผู้ช่วย: ปฏิวัติการวิเคราะห์ข้อมูลโดยยึดตาม: การดำเนินการที่ชาญฉลาด   |  สร้างรหัส  |  สร้างสูตรที่กำหนดเอง  |  วิเคราะห์ข้อมูลและสร้างแผนภูมิ  |  เรียกใช้ฟังก์ชัน Kutools...
คุณสมบัติยอดนิยม: ค้นหา เน้น หรือระบุรายการที่ซ้ำกัน   |  ลบแถวว่าง   |  รวมคอลัมน์หรือเซลล์โดยไม่สูญเสียข้อมูล   |   รอบโดยไม่มีสูตร ...
การค้นหาขั้นสูง: VLookup หลายเกณฑ์    VLookup หลายค่า  |   VLookup ข้ามหลายแผ่น   |   การค้นหาที่ไม่ชัดเจน ....
รายการแบบเลื่อนลงขั้นสูง: สร้างรายการแบบหล่นลงอย่างรวดเร็ว   |  รายการแบบหล่นลงขึ้นอยู่กับ   |  เลือกหลายรายการแบบหล่นลง ....
ผู้จัดการคอลัมน์: เพิ่มจำนวนคอลัมน์เฉพาะ  |  ย้ายคอลัมน์  |  สลับสถานะการมองเห็นของคอลัมน์ที่ซ่อนอยู่  |  เปรียบเทียบช่วงและคอลัมน์ ...
คุณสมบัติเด่น: กริดโฟกัส   |  มุมมองการออกแบบ   |   บาร์สูตรใหญ่    สมุดงานและตัวจัดการชีต   |  ห้องสมุดทรัพยากร (ข้อความอัตโนมัติ)   |  เลือกวันที่   |  รวมแผ่นงาน   |  เข้ารหัส/ถอดรหัสเซลล์    ส่งอีเมลตามรายการ   |  ซุปเปอร์ฟิลเตอร์   |   ตัวกรองพิเศษ (กรองตัวหนา/ตัวเอียง/ขีดทับ...) ...
ชุดเครื่องมือ 15 อันดับแรก12 ข้อความ เครื่องมือ (เพิ่มข้อความ, ลบอักขระ, ... )   |   50 + แผนภูมิ ประเภท (แผนภูมิ Gantt, ... )   |   40+ ใช้งานได้จริง สูตร (คำนวณอายุตามวันเกิด, ... )   |   19 การแทรก เครื่องมือ (ใส่ QR Code, แทรกรูปภาพจากเส้นทาง, ... )   |   12 การแปลง เครื่องมือ (ตัวเลขเป็นคำ, การแปลงสกุลเงิน, ... )   |   7 ผสานและแยก เครื่องมือ (แถวรวมขั้นสูง, แยกเซลล์, ... )   |   ... และอื่น ๆ

เพิ่มพูนทักษะ Excel ของคุณด้วย Kutools สำหรับ Excel และสัมผัสประสิทธิภาพอย่างที่ไม่เคยมีมาก่อน Kutools สำหรับ Excel เสนอคุณสมบัติขั้นสูงมากกว่า 300 รายการเพื่อเพิ่มประสิทธิภาพและประหยัดเวลา  คลิกที่นี่เพื่อรับคุณสมบัติที่คุณต้องการมากที่สุด...

รายละเอียด


แท็บ Office นำอินเทอร์เฟซแบบแท็บมาที่ Office และทำให้งานของคุณง่ายขึ้นมาก

  • เปิดใช้งานการแก้ไขและอ่านแบบแท็บใน Word, Excel, PowerPoint, ผู้จัดพิมพ์, Access, Visio และโครงการ
  • เปิดและสร้างเอกสารหลายรายการในแท็บใหม่ของหน้าต่างเดียวกันแทนที่จะเป็นในหน้าต่างใหม่
  • เพิ่มประสิทธิภาพการทำงานของคุณ 50% และลดการคลิกเมาส์หลายร้อยครั้งให้คุณทุกวัน!
Comments (6)
No ratings yet. Be the first to rate!
This comment was minimized by the moderator on the site
"Only when the two workbook are open at the same time (the source data workbook and the data validation workbook), the external data validation can correctly work." Yes this is rather a big problem isn't it? We would not usually have two workbooks open at the same time, we more likely wish to use an old workbook and simply copy the data validation rules to the new spreadsheet. I gave up trying to do this using copy and paste, instead wrote a VBA macro which applied the data validation rule to a large number of cells in one go. Use 'Record Macro' to set up the VBA commands and make minor adjustments to the resulting code to do the trick. Worked fine.
This comment was minimized by the moderator on the site
Glad its not just me that can't get the external data validation to work. Frustratingly it seemed to once but never again. No idea what I did that time.
This comment was minimized by the moderator on the site
Hello, thanks for showing us how to have a drop-down list linked to an external file. However I could not set up the Data Validation to work, even though I have selected to STOP any invalid entry, which a number not included in the drop-down list itself. Is there any way where I can circumnavigate this?
This comment was minimized by the moderator on the site
Create external data validation in different workbook. This tips not working for sharing file one PC to another PC. How it will works? pls. suggest me.
This comment was minimized by the moderator on the site
Sorry I have no idea on this.
This comment was minimized by the moderator on the site
Thank you so much for this article! I could not get Excel to allow me to reference another sheet for a data validation list. I can only surmise that it is because of the version. Very frustrating! However, I did not know about naming the data list, and by doing so and using the =[data list name], it worked like a charm. Many thanks!
There are no comments posted here yet
Please leave your comments in English
Posting as Guest
×
Rate this post:
0   Characters
Suggested Locations